部署elk+kafkaZookeeper是一种在分布式系统中被广泛用来作为:分布式状态管理、分布式协调管理、分布式配置管理、分布式锁服务的集群zookeeper功能非常强大,可以实现诸如分布式应用配置管理、统一命名服务、状态同步服务、集群管理等功能,我们这里拿比较简单的分布式应用配置管理为例来说明。假设我们的程序是分布式部署在多台机器上,如果我们要改变程序的配置文件,需要逐台机器去修改,非常麻烦
ELK是ElasticSerach、Logstash、Kibana三款产品名称的首字母集合,用于日志的搜集搜索,今天我们一起搭建和体验基于ELK的日志服务;环境规划本次实战需要两台电脑(或者vmware下的两个虚拟机),操作系统都是CentOS7,它们的身份、配置、地址等信息如下:hostnameIP地址身份配置elk-server192.168.119.132ELK服务端,接收日志,提供日志搜
0x00 概述 测试搭建一个使用kafka作为消息队列的ELK环境,数据采集转换实现结构如下: F5 HSL–>logstash(流处理)–> kafka –>elasticsearch 测试中的elk版本为6.3, confluent版本是4.1.1 希望实现的效果是 HSL发送的日志胫骨logs
原创 2022-05-25 00:55:09
931阅读
之前ELK的安装可以查看前面一篇博客 下面是我的logback的配置文件,通过logback的appender直接导入logstash <?xml version="1.0" encoding="UTF-8"?> <configuration> <include resource="org/spri
转载 2019-12-03 15:30:00
119阅读
2评论
# 如何实现Python结合ELK ## 简介 在本文中,我们将介绍如何使用Python结合ELK(Elasticsearch、LogstashKibana)来进行日志处理可视化。ELK是一套用于收集、存储、搜索、分析可视化日志数据的开源工具。Python是一种流行的编程语言,可以帮助我们更轻松地与ELK进行交互。 ### 流程图 ```mermaid flowchart TD;
原创 5月前
55阅读
0 说明本次EFK分布式日志收集系统节点安排如下:主机名主机ip部署情况chen-1192.168.218.100Elasticsearsh Logstash Filebeat Namenode ResourceManager ZKchen-2192.168.218.101Elasticsearsh SecondaryNamenode Datanode Nodemanager ZKchen-319
文章目录一、在windows系统中安装redis1、下载2、安装二、在lunix系统中安装1.下载a、首先是创建安装目录b、然后通过链接,将压缩包下载到该文件c、进行解压,并解压到当前文件夹d、进行编译及安装e、启动服务器测试 一、在windows系统中安装redis目前redis 在windows系统中使用的不多,目前更新到3.2.100版本就已经停止更新了。1、下载点击下载地址:https:
Flume 与 Kakfa结合例子(Kakfa 作为flume 的sink 输出到 Kafka topic) 进行准备工作: 编辑 flume的配置文件: $ cat /home/tester/flafka/spooldir_kafka.conf # Name the components on t
转载 2017-10-23 20:43:00
143阅读
2评论
在单台主机上搭建kafka + zookeeper 集群。zookeeper 集群搭建kafka是通过zookeeper来管理集群。 kafka 软件包内虽然包括了一个简版的 zookeeper,但是感觉功能有限。在生产环境下,建议还是直接下载官方zookeeper软件。最新版的zookeeper软件下载链接wget http://mirrors.cnnic.cn/apache/zookeeper
况下,先进入kafka 的安装目录下, bin 目录中存放了很多执行脚本, 在不输入参数的时候,会显示该脚本的帮助 连接的服务地址与端口,则查看conf 中的配置文件 2
原创 2022-10-15 01:43:28
80阅读
Kafka是什么?一句话概括:「Apache Kafka 是一款开源的消息引擎系统」什么是消息引擎系统?消息引擎系统(Message Broker System)是一种中间件软件或服务,用于在分布式系统中进行异步消息传递。它提供了可靠的消息传输、消息路由消息处理的功能,使不同的应用程序组件能够通过发送接收消息进行通信。消息引擎系统通常由以下几个核心组件组成:发布者(Publisher):负责
转载 1月前
14阅读
前言最近公司skywalking服务经常出现大盘空白的情况,经查明,是由于ES的写入瓶颈造成线程阻塞,数据没有落地到ES造成。后综合运维成本等方面考虑,准备使用阿里云提供的Elasticsearch服务,阿里云的ES无论内外网都加上了Http Basic认证,但是skywalking6.x提供的RestHighLevelClient客户端并没有适配带Http Basic基础认证的ES服务,所
背景:首先用jmeter录制或者书写性能测试的脚本,用maven添加相关依赖,把性能测试的代码提交到github,在jenkins配置git下载性能测试的代码,配置运行脚本测试报告,配置运行失败自动发邮件通知,这样一来性能测试的job配置完成。接着,把性能测试的job配置成开发job的下游job,一旦开发有了新的代码提交运行开发自己的job后,就会自动触发我们性能测试的job。这样我们就实现了接
平时做项目,涉及到网络层的都是epoll,前几年发现redis的epoll实现起来非常的精简,好用。因为提供的接口简单,爱并实现的很高效。于是,我就提取出来,直接使用。今天又打开该文件详细的看看他的实现细节。首先简单介绍epoll,它是linux内核下的一个高效的处理大批量的文件操作符的一个实现。不仅限于socket fd。他在超时时间内会唤醒有事件的操作符。其中有两种模式 1、水平触发(Leve
总的思路: 所有安装配置步骤基本都一样下载tar包,解压,修改配置文件,启动。 下载tar包和解压的过程就不再赘述,直接去官网上下载。 elk的安装包我用的是6.7.1。kafka用的2.1.1。 kafka -> logstash -> elasticsearch 这是我的数据流向。 所有解压后的软件装在/opt/module目录下 。 opt目录是linux系统中的软件存放目录。k
本旅游服务软件,主要实现了管理员后端:首页、个人中心、旅游攻略管理、旅游资讯管理、景点信息管理、门票预定管理、用户管理、酒店信息管理、酒店预定管理、推荐路线管理、论坛管理、系统管理,用户前端:首页、景点信息、酒店信息、论坛中心、我的等。总体设计主要包括系统功能设计、该系统里充分综合应用Mysql数据库、JAVA等相关知识。网页界面的构成,具备简单易懂、便捷等特征。设计过程中,第一,静态页面的制作需
## 如何实现docker kafka ### 概述 在开始教你如何实现docker kafka之前,我们先来了解一下kafka是什么。Kafka是一个分布式流处理平台,它能够处理海量的实时数据流,并具有高可靠性可扩展性。而docker则是一个开源的容器化平台,可以帮助我们更方便地构建、部署管理应用程序。 实现docker kafka的过程可以分为以下几个步骤: 1. 准备Docker环境
原创 2023-08-13 03:14:09
68阅读
# Java Kafka动态topicsgroupId Kafka是一个分布式流处理平台,它提供了高性能、持久性、可扩展性容错性。在Kafka中,topics是消息的分类,可以将消息发送到不同的topics中以便消费者进行订阅。而groupId是消费者组的标识,可以让多个消费者同时消费同一个topic中的消息。 在实际应用中,有时候需要动态创建topicsgroupId来满足业务需求。本
原创 1月前
73阅读
我是廖志伟,一名Java开发工程师、幕后大佬社区创始人、Java领域优质创作者、CSDN博客专家。拥有多年一线研发经验,研究过各
原创 2022-05-17 14:53:32
118阅读
深度剖析SkyWalking分布式链路追踪源码分析skywalking分布式链路追踪流程大致如下: 1.Agent 采集数据 2.Agent 发送数据到Collector 3.Collector 接收数据 4.Collector 将接收的数据储存到持久层代码分析我们从apm-sniffer工程开始出发(sniffer既嗅探器、探针的意思)以SkyWalkingAgent类中Premain进行程序的
  • 1
  • 2
  • 3
  • 4
  • 5